Tomato Fusarium wilt

Solanum lycopersicum L.

A fungal disease caused by the soil-borne pathogen Fusarium oxysporum f. sp. lycopersici, which attacks the vascular system of the plant. It is characterized by wilting and specific browning of the stem vascular bundles.

The causal agent of the disease is the fungus Fusarium oxysporum f. sp. lycopersici, which is subdivided into three physiological races. The distribution of these races is determined by their ability to overcome the genetic resistance of host cultivars; races 1 and 2 are found worldwide, while the range of race 3 is gradually expanding.

Key symptoms include unilateral yellowing and wilting of leaves, starting from the lower part of the plant, as well as brown or chocolate-brown discoloration of the vascular bundles in a stem cross-section. The disease is most pronounced during the flowering and active fruiting periods, leading to leaf deformation and plant death.

Breeding for resistance is based on the use of the I, I-2, and I-3 genes, which provide protection against the first, second, and third races of the pathogen, respectively. In the documentation for cultivars and hybrids, the presence of such resistance is indicated by the code Fol with the specification of the corresponding races and the level of resistance.
